SF6 (or Sulphur Hexafluoride) has been the standard gas used inside high voltage electrical equipment as an insulating and arc-quenching medium. However, SF6 is also listed as a potent greenhouse gas according to the Kyoto Protocol, with 24,300 times the comparative Global Warming Potential (GWP) of CO2 and a lifetime of 1,000 years in the atmosphere. Improved Cyber Security for Lentronics SONET/SDH Multiplexers

GE’s Lentronics™ Cyber Secured Service Unit (CSSU) protects Lentronics Multiplexers against cyber threats, specifically those that target the reliability of the Bulk Electric System (BES). The CSSU is an essential security appliance that takes the place of a legacy Service or IP Service Unit, to better protect against malicious and unintentional network changes. It utilizes defense-in-depth strategies, allowing utilities to meet demanding security standards such as NERC CIP.

Acting as a secure gateway between Lentronics Multiplexers and the Lentronics VistaNET NMS software, CSSUs employ strong AES 256 bit encryption, SSL/TLS and X.509 digital certificates to ensure privacy and authenticity of users attempting to access the network.

Overview

The Lentronics Cyber Secured Service Unit protects Lentronics multiplexers from unauthorized user access and remote equipment configuration. In addition, non-authenticated software clients will be actively rejected along with failed user authentication attempts. The use of strong privacy policies help prevent man-in-the-middle attacks.

Each CSSU communicates with adjacent CSSUs over the SONET/SDH overhead to facilitate:

  • Centralized user authentication
  • Distribution of a common, network-wide security policy
  • Distribution of common security settings, including digital certificates
  • Upgrade of the units operating firmware to apply any future patches
  • Distribution of the current time

This extends the electronic security perimeter around each NMS access point, securing all sites, particularly remote locations containing critical assets belonging to critical BES Cyber Systems.

GE Cyber Secured Service Unit Security Features
Access Control

A Cyber Secured Service Unit can be deployed in one of two operational modes, Legacy or Secure. Legacy mode (CSSU-L) offers a consistent set of features that supports interoperability with pre-existing Service or IP Service Units.

Secure mode (CSSU-S) is a licensed component that must be applied to all CSSUs within a ring, or across the entire management domain. In this case, a network-wide security envelope is formed to protect and control assets through Authentication, Authorization, Accountability, Privacy and Integrity.
